Before making reservations here, I wasn’t sure if this campground was operating because of information I found online. While making the reservation, I talked to a woman on the phone (the owner) and she said it was $25 a night for a full hookup. They only accept cash or check and you pay when you get there. I wasn’t assigned a reservation number but the owner said assured me I had a spot booked and it’s just her and her husband that work there. When I got there, I was assigned site 29. Overall, I was looking for something close to downtown Point Pleasant and this was a good fit. There is no wifi and cell service was a little spotty (I had 1-3 bars at times for cell service). There’s a park with a trail that you can walk or bike around. There’s also a fort nearby that you can check out. Even though this campground didn’t have all the bells and whistles like some of the other once’s I’ve stayed at, you can’t beat the price.

Friendly and communicative hosts. Can’t beat the price of $25/night for a full hookup. What I didn’t realize when booking is that this park is situated in a city park with an old fort, large pond, small pollinator garden, and 1 mile paved walking path around the pond. This was a lovely surprise! Plenty of space for the kids to run around and burn off energy. Ground does get very muddy during/after rain. Probably wouldn’t stay here for too long as there wasn’t much to do but it was perfect for what we needed, a place to stop as we were passing through town.

Excellent CG. Apparently owned by the city so its right next to a great play ground, splash park and lake for fishing. 1 mile paves walking trail all the way around the lake was nice. Looks like they used to rent kayaks and paddle boats at 1 time. Laundry on site says closed but it was the weekend. Great park for only $25/night with full hookups 50/30 amps water and sewer. Would recommend to everyone.
